Job Title:
Food Service Associate
- Job Description
- Responsible for the final preparation of all food items served in the food service area in accordance with guidelines and regulations, and as directed by the kitchen supervisor or team leader. Candidates will be required to correctly portion and plate food based on work instructions and maintain a clean and safe work station. It is imperative to follow all safety and sanitation procedures.
- Responsibilities
- + Prepare all food items served in the food service area following guidelines and regulations. + Correctly portion and plate food based on work instructions. + Maintain a clean and safe work station. + Follow all safety and sanitation procedures.
- Essential Skills
- + Experience in food service, food preparation, and tray line operations. + Skill in food portioning and plating. + Ability to provide excellent customer service.
- Additional Skills & Qualifications
- + Ability to read and comprehend written instructions. + Basic math skills, such as adding and subtracting two-digit numbers to calculate portioning. + Demonstrate safe and correct use of cleaning products.
- Why Work Here
- These positions offer the opportunity to become permanent employees with full-time benefits and annual pay increases based on performance and tenure. Experience the change of pace and consistency with hours when working in the hospital environment, offering steady and consistent work compared to the hectic nature of restaurant shifts.
- Work Environment
- The role is based in a kitchen environment inside a hospital, characterized by a team-oriented culture where everyone works collectively to deliver on the dietary needs of patients, hospital staff, and visitors.
The dress code includes black pants, a black shirt, and slip-resistant shoes. Candidates’ work schedule will remain constant during the contract, but after becoming permanent, they will move to a schedule that includes working every other weekend. The shifts are Sunday to Thursday, with options for 6:30 am to 2:00 pm or 1:00 pm to 9:00 pm, and Tuesday to Thursday with the same shift options.
